What is the California Settlement Conference Statement?
The California Settlement Conference Statement is a crucial legal form in the Superior Court of California, County of Butte. Its main purpose is to facilitate settlement discussions between parties involved in legal proceedings. This statement requires the attendees' information, a summary of past settlement discussions, and the key issues of the case to be clearly outlined.
Key components include case issues, relevant attendee details, and summaries of previous discussions to guide the court and the parties involved. Understanding the significance of this form can lead to more effective resolution strategies and improved communication during settlement negotiations.

Who is eligible to file the California Settlement Conference Statement?
Any party involved in a legal case within the Superior Court of California, particularly in Butte County, is eligible to file the California Settlement Conference Statement.
What is the deadline for submitting this form?
The California Settlement Conference Statement must be filed and served at least five court days before the scheduled settlement conference to ensure timely processing.

Are there any required supporting documents for this form?
While the California Settlement Conference Statement itself is the primary document, it’s advisable to have any relevant case files, correspondence, or prior settlement offers ready to support your submission.
What are some common mistakes to avoid when filling out the form?
Ensure that all fields are completed accurately, double-check names and case details, and verify that the document does not exceed the page limit to avoid delays in processing.
What is the processing time for the California Settlement Conference Statement?
Processing times can vary depending on court schedules, but submitting the statement at least five days before the conference generally allows adequate time for court review.
Is notarization required for this form?
No, the California Settlement Conference Statement does not require notarization; however, the submitting party must sign and date the form.
